FEATURES
* * * * * * * * UL217 Approved = 880 nm Chip material = AlGaAs Package type: T-1 3/4 (5mm lens diameter) Matched Photosensor: QSB34 Narrow Emission Angle, 18 High Output Power Package material and color: Clear, peach

ABSOLUTE MAXIMUM RATINGS (TA = 25C unless otherwise specified)
Parameter Operating Temperature Storage Temperature Soldering Temperature (Iron)(2,3,4) Soldering Temperature (Flow)(2,3) Continuous Forward Current Reverse Voltage Power Dissipation(1) Symbol TOPR TSTG TSOL-I TSOL-F IF VR PD Rating -40 to + 100 -40 to + 100 240 for 5 sec 260 for 10 sec 100 5 200 Unit C C C C mA V mW
NOTES: 1. Derate power dissipation linearly 2.67 mW/C above 25C. 2. RMA flux is recommended. 3. Methanol or isopropyl alcohols are recommended as cleaning agents. 4. Soldering iron 1/16" (1.6 mm) minimum from housing .
